Free Will Baptist Church Pea Ridge

Bro. Don Deckard will continue the new convert classes, which are open to any interested in learning more about God’s Plan of Salvation at 7 p.m. Thursday, Dec. 2. Classes are every other Thursday night.

At 8 a.m. Saturday, Dec.

4, there will be a children’s “Giving Gallery” - an indoor yard and bake sale and craft bazaar. Children 12 and under are invited to shop for family and friends where all items are priced a dollar or less. There will be adult supervison and volunteers to assist the younger children with their puchases. All items will be gift wrapped free.

The yard sale items will consist of “gently” used items reasonably priced with no clothing. Bazaar items are all hand and homemade. Christmas decorations, wooden nativity scenes, Alta Barnard’slye soap, quilted items, jellies, apple butter, candy, cookies, pumpkin and pecan pies are just a few of the items that will be availble. All proceeds go to support the church building fund.
